Description
Monolithic Microwave Integrated Circuits (MMICs) are widely used for realizing microwave subsystems which find use in communications, RADAR and other defence systems. Development and acceptance of products for Defence and Space applications requires adherence to stringent qualification and screening criteria. The Gallium Arsenide Enabling Technology Centre (GAETEC) at Hyderabad, is a vertically integrated foundry with design, fabrication, assembly, testing, packaging and module making facilities. At present GAETEC is running 0.7 and 0.5 micron MESFET-based microwave circuit technologies at different frequency ranges. GAETEC has productionised several indigenous R&D efforts carried out at Solid State Physics Laboratory (SSPL), DRDO, Delhi, and delivered several critical MMICs and application specific RF modules for Defence applications and ISRO satellite space missions. The presentation will cover the GaAs and GaN technology devices and MMICs technologies at GAETEC and typical road map from R&D to a qualified production worthy technology.
